Amazon Data Engineer, AWS Field Exp - BPO - BPX in Dallas, Texas

Description

Amazon Web Services has been the world’s most comprehensive and broadly adopted cloud platform. AWS offers over 100 fully featured services to millions of active customers around the world—including the fastest-growing startups, largest enterprises, and leading government agencies—to power their infrastructure. Business Product & Operations (BPO) is a diverse team that supports infrastructure and other foundational initiatives that span and support Sales, Marketing, and Global Services Operations teams within AWS. We are looking for a hands-on Data Engineer with experience developing and delivering data platform as we build the next iteration of a GenAI based self service platform for Business Insights. Come join a team at the beginning of a product life cycle and help define the way AWS does business with its key customers.

As a Data Engineer in AWS, you will partner with cross-functional teams, including Business Intelligence Engineers, Analysts, Software Developers, and Product Managers, to develop scalable and maintainable data pipelines on both structured and unstructured data. The ideal candidate has strong business judgment, a good sense of architectural design, excellent written and documentation skills, and experience with big data technologies (Spark/Hive, Redshift, EMR, and other AWS technologies). This role involves overseeing existing pipelines as well as developing brand new ones. The operating environment is fast-paced and dynamic, with a strong team-oriented and welcoming culture. To thrive, you must be detail-oriented, enthusiastic, and flexible, and in return, you will gain tremendous experience with the latest big data technologies and exposure to various use cases to improve process effectiveness, customer experience, and automation.

Key job responsibilities

  • Design and implement scalable and efficient data pipelines to ingest, transform, and load data from various sources into AWS data stores (e.g., Amazon S3, Amazon Redshift, Amazon DynamoDB, Amazon Athena)

  • Develop and maintain data 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) processes using AWS services such as AWS Glue, AWS Lambda, AWS EMR, and AWS Step Functions

  • Ensure data integrity, security, and compliance by implementing appropriate data governance policies and access controls

  • Automate data monitoring, alerting, and incident response processes to ensure the reliability and availability of data pipelines

  • Collaborate with data analysts, business intelligence engineers, and business stakeholders to understand data requirements and design solutions to meet their needs

  • Empower technical and non-technical, internal customers to drive their own analytics and reporting by building a self-serve platform and support ad-hoc reporting when needed.

  • Participate in the implementation of data lakes, data warehouses, and other data management solutions on the AWS platform

  • Stay up-to-date with the latest AWS data services, features, and best practices, and recommend improvements to the data architecture

  • Provide technical support and troubleshooting for issues related to data pipelines, data quality, and data processing

Basic Qualifications

  • 3+ years of data engineering experience

  • Experience with SQL

  • Experience in at least one modern scripting or programming language, such as Python, Java, Scala, or NodeJS

  • Experience with data modeling, warehousing and building ETL pipelines

  • Knowledge of distributed systems as it pertains to data storage and computing

Preferred Qualifications

  • Experience with AWS technologies like Redshift, S3, AWS Glue, EMR, Kinesis, FireHose, Lambda, and IAM roles and permissions

  • Experience with Apache Spark / Elastic Map Reduce

  • Experience with non-relational databases / data stores (object storage, document or key-value stores, graph databases, column-family databases)

  • Experience building/operating highly available, distributed systems of data extraction, ingestion, and processing of large data sets

  • Knowledge of professional software engineering & best practices for full software development life cycle, including coding standards, software architectures, code reviews, source control management, continuous deployments, testing, and operational excellence

  • Experience working on and delivering end to end projects independently

Our compensation reflects the cost of labor across several US geographic markets. The base pay for this position ranges from $118,900/year in our lowest geographic market up to $205,600/year in our highest geographic market. Pay is based on a number of factors including market location and may vary depending on job-related knowledge, skills, and experience. Amazon is a total compensation company. Dependent on the position offered, equity, sign-on payments, and other forms of compensation may be provided as part of a total compensation package, in addition to a full range of medical, financial, and/or other benefits.
